Twitter competitor Spill launches in beta on iOS.

From a team of ex-Twitter employees, the new social platform Spill launched in an invite-only beta on the App Store.

It’s been quite the year for Spill CEO Alphonzo “Phonz” Terrell. This time last year, he was global head of social and editorial at Twitter, which had not yet been sold to Elon Musk. Since then, he was laid off, started a new company and raised a $2.75 million pre-seed round.

Spill is a visual-first, multimedia microblogging app with an interface that looks kind of like Tumblr. When you open the app, you land on a feed, which includes recent posts from people you’re following (or, in the app’s language, “sipping”), as well as algorithmically served posts. From there, you can pull down a top menu, which shows trending posts and hashtags, like #spillionaires, #zaddiesofspill and #baddiesofspill, which have all emerged as early monikers for the app’s users. From the bottom menu, users can post text, gifs, videos, photos, links and polls.
